7 LEGENDS + TALES • Volume 9• 2021 OSBORNE VILLAGE Just south of downtown, Osborne Village is an invitingly walkable stretch that gives the block a party vibe, especially in summer. Independent fashion boutiques intermingle with some of Winnipeg's more brilliant restaurants (some with hidden patios) and bars of both the dive and craft cocktail variety. It all makes for a gem of a place to visit, night or day. osbornevillage.com CORYDON AVENUE The spot to be on summer evenings as crowds of people gather to meet, dine al fresco and savour some of the best food and gelati in the city. Once known as Winnipeg's "Little Italy," Corydon Avenue now features a wide array of cuisine from regional fare to Japanese to Indian and of course, classic Italian. Whether stopping for a quick espresso or out for a night on the town, Corydon Avenue is sure to delight all of your senses. corydonbiz.com SERENE STAYS New properties Located across from the RBC Convention Centre Winnipeg, Sutton Place Hotels is opening a 275-room hotel in 2021. The property is part of a transformative new downtown plaza now under construction, which will include enclosed skywalks, boutiques, restaurants, and green space, breathing new life and vibrancy into the city's core. Hyatt is moving into the Winnipeg market with the opening of two new properties. Opening in 2019 is Hyatt House Winnipeg South West by Outlet Collection Winnipeg and IKEA. Hyatt Place Downtown is slated for opening in 2020. The 122-suite Residence Inn by Marriott in Winnipeg, Manitoba is an all-suite property connected to the existing Fairfield Inn & Suites, making it the first dual-branded property in Winnipeg. Best Western Premier Transcona is set to open August 2019, featuring 141 rooms and suites, conference room, Bistro Bar and indoor pool with waterslide. Unique and recognized properties The Fort Garry Hotel, Spa and Conference Centre is a former Grand Trunk Railway Hotel with more than 100 years of history – and is famous for its haunted residents. The hotel boasts a world-class spa and the opulent Palm Lounge. Sparrow Properties is a local chain of hotels. Inn at the Forks is an eco-friendly property with one of the city's hottest new restaurants, SMITH, a spa with treatments that also incorporate Indigenous traditions, and stylish rooms. The architecturally suave Mere Hotel is located on Waterfront Drive and boasts river views. Brand name hotels include The Fairmont, Radisson, Holiday Inn, Hilton, Hampton Inn, Fairfield Inn & Suites, Courtyard by Marriott and more.
